Bing Yao is a scholar working on Molecular Biology, Electrical and Electronic Engineering and Materials Chemistry. According to data from OpenAlex, Bing Yao has authored 478 papers receiving a total of 13.4k indexed citations (citations by other indexed papers that have themselves been cited), including 140 papers in Molecular Biology, 112 papers in Electrical and Electronic Engineering and 64 papers in Materials Chemistry. Recurrent topics in Bing Yao’s work include Organic Light-Emitting Diodes Research (49 papers), Organic Electronics and Photovoltaics (38 papers) and Epigenetics and DNA Methylation (36 papers). Bing Yao is often cited by papers focused on Organic Light-Emitting Diodes Research (49 papers), Organic Electronics and Photovoltaics (38 papers) and Epigenetics and DNA Methylation (36 papers). Bing Yao collaborates with scholars based in China, United States and Hong Kong. Bing Yao's co-authors include Zhiyuan Xie, Peng Jin, Lixiang Wang, Wai‐Yeung Wong, Raymond C. Harris, Baohua Zhang, Ming‐Zhi Zhang, Guo‐li Ming, Kimberly M. Christian and Junqiao Ding and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Angewandte Chemie International Edition and Nucleic Acids Research.
